Abstract
This review presents most of the literature data about synthesis and biological activity of pyrazolo[4,3-c]heterocyclic derivatives. Pyrazolo[4,3-c]heterocyclic derivatives show the antimicrobial, anti-inflammatory, antiviral, antitumor, analgesic and antiphlogistic activities, and effects on the nervous and immune system. The broad spectrum of biological activity of pyrazolo[4,3-c]heterocyclic derivatives is the main reason for the preparation of new compounds containing this scaffold.
